[BACK]Return to configure.in CVS log [TXT][DIR] Up to [local] / OpenXM_contrib2 / asir2000

Diff for /OpenXM_contrib2/asir2000/configure.in between version 1.25 and 1.52

version 1.25, 2007/11/11 08:44:12 version 1.52, 2019/11/12 10:52:04
Line 1 
Line 1 
 dnl $OpenXM: OpenXM_contrib2/asir2000/configure.in,v 1.24 2007/02/18 05:36:27 ohara Exp $  dnl $OpenXM: OpenXM_contrib2/asir2000/configure.in,v 1.51 2019/03/26 08:10:13 ohara Exp $
   
 AC_INIT  AC_INIT(asir,1.15)
 AC_CONFIG_SRCDIR([LICENSE])  AC_CONFIG_SRCDIR([LICENSE])
 AC_PREREQ(2.61)  AC_PREREQ(2.69)
 AC_CANONICAL_TARGET  AC_CANONICAL_TARGET
 AM_INIT_AUTOMAKE(asir, 20030307)  AM_INIT_AUTOMAKE
 AM_MAINTAINER_MODE  AM_MAINTAINER_MODE
   
 dnl AM_PROG_AS  dnl AM_PROG_AS
Line 16  AC_PROG_YACC
Line 16  AC_PROG_YACC
   
 AC_PATH_XTRA  AC_PATH_XTRA
   
 AC_DEFINE([HMEXT])  
   
 AC_ARG_ENABLE([shared],  AC_ARG_ENABLE([shared],
 [  --enable-shared         enable linking shared libraries.  [[no]]],  [  --enable-shared         enable linking shared libraries.  [[no]]],
 [enable_shared=yes],[enable_shared=no])  [enable_shared=yes],[enable_shared=no])
Line 36  elif test `basename ./"${CC}"` = "icc" ; then
Line 34  elif test `basename ./"${CC}"` = "icc" ; then
     CFLAGS="-g -O"      CFLAGS="-g -O"
 fi  fi
   
 GC=gc6.8  GC=gc-7.4.2
   AC_ARG_WITH([asir-gc],
   [  --with-asir-gc          modify Boehm's GC [[yes]]],
   [with_asir_gc=${withval}],[with_asir_gc=yes])
   if test ${with_asir_gc:=yes} != no; then
      ASIR_GCLIB=libasir-gc.a
      GCINC='-I${top_srcdir}/${GC}/include'
   else
      GCLIB='-L${prefix}/lib -lgc'
      GCINC='-I${prefix}/include'
      AC_DEFINE([NO_ASIR_GC])
   fi
 dnl GC_CONFIGURE_ARGS=--disable-threads --enable-shared=no  dnl GC_CONFIGURE_ARGS=--disable-threads --enable-shared=no
 GC_CONFIGURE_ARGS=--disable-threads  GC_CONFIGURE_ARGS="--disable-threads --enable-large-config"
 if [ -n "${host_alias}" ]; then  if test -n "${host_alias}" ; then
     GC_CONFIGURE_ARGS="--host=${host_alias} ${GC_CONFIGURE_ARGS}"      GC_CONFIGURE_ARGS="--host=${host_alias} ${GC_CONFIGURE_ARGS}"
 fi  fi
   
   AC_DEFINE([GC7])
   AC_SUBST([ASIR_GCLIB])
   AC_SUBST([GCLIB])
   AC_SUBST([GCINC])
 AC_SUBST([GC])  AC_SUBST([GC])
 AC_SUBST([GC_CONFIGURE_ARGS])  AC_SUBST([GC_CONFIGURE_ARGS])
   
Line 54  if test ${with_distdir:=no} != no -a ${with_distdir} !
Line 68  if test ${with_distdir:=no} != no -a ${with_distdir} !
 fi  fi
 AC_SUBST([GC_DISTDIR])  AC_SUBST([GC_DISTDIR])
   
 AC_ARG_ENABLE([gc-zeropage],  
 [  --enable-gc-zeropage    enable to avoid the kernel zeropage bug.  [[no]]],  
 [enable_gc_zeropage=yes],[enable_gc_zeropage=no])  
   
 if test "${enable_gc_zeropage:=no}" != no ; then  
     USE_GC_ZEROPAGE="yes"  
 fi  
 AC_SUBST([USE_GC_ZEROPAGE])  
   
 libasir_postfix=""  libasir_postfix=""
 AC_ARG_WITH([pari],  AC_ARG_WITH([pari],
 [  --with-pari             use the PARI library. [[no]]],  [  --with-pari             use the PARI library. [[no]]],
Line 70  AC_ARG_WITH([pari],
Line 75  AC_ARG_WITH([pari],
   
 if test ${with_pari:=no} != no ; then  if test ${with_pari:=no} != no ; then
     libasir_postfix=${libasir_postfix}_pari      libasir_postfix=${libasir_postfix}_pari
     if test ${with_pari} = new ; then  
         libpari=pari-2.2  
     else  
         libpari=pari  
     fi  
     PARIINC='-I${prefix}/include/pari'      PARIINC='-I${prefix}/include/pari'
     if test "${enable_shared}" != yes ; then      if test "${enable_shared}" != yes ; then
         PARILIB='${prefix}'"/lib/lib${libpari}.a"          PARILIB='${libdir}/libpari.a'
     else      else
         PARILIB='-L${prefix}/lib'" -l${libpari}"          PARILIB='-L${libdir} -lpari'
     fi      fi
     AC_DEFINE([PARI])      AC_DEFINE([PARI])
 fi  fi
Line 109  if test ${enable_plot:=no} != no ; then
Line 109  if test ${enable_plot:=no} != no ; then
 fi  fi
 AM_CONDITIONAL([USE_PLOT],[test "$enable_plot" = yes])  AM_CONDITIONAL([USE_PLOT],[test "$enable_plot" = yes])
   
   GMPLIB="-L${libdir} -lmpfi -lmpc -lmpfr -lgmp"
   AC_ARG_ENABLE([static_gmp],
   [  --enable-static-gmp     force to link statically with gmp. [[no]]],
   [enable_static_gmp=yes],[enable_static_gmp=no])
   if test ${enable_static_gmp:=no} != no ; then
       GMPLIB='${libdir}/libmpc.a ${libdir}/libmpfr.a ${libdir}/libgmp.a'
   fi
   AC_SUBST([GMPLIB])
   
 AC_ARG_ENABLE([interval],  AC_ARG_ENABLE([interval],
 [  --enable-interval       enable interval feature. [[no]]],  [  --enable-interval       enable interval feature. [[no]]],
 [enable_interval=${enableval}],[enable_interval=no])  [enable_interval=${enableval}],[enable_interval=no])
Line 139  if test "${enable_fft_float:=no}" != no ; then
Line 148  if test "${enable_fft_float:=no}" != no ; then
     AC_DEFINE([USE_FLOAT])      AC_DEFINE([USE_FLOAT])
 fi  fi
   
 dnl AC_ARG_WITH([mpi],  AC_ARG_WITH([mpi],
 dnl [  --with-mpi              use the MPI library. [[no]]],  [  --with-mpi              use the MPI library. [[no]]],
 dnl [with_mpi=${withval}],[with_mpi=no])  [with_mpi=${withval}],[with_mpi=no])
   
 if test "${with_mpi:=no}" != no ; then  if test "${with_mpi:=no}" != no ; then
     MPIINC="-I/opt/FJSVmpi2/include"  
     MPILIB="-L/opt/FJSVmpi2/lib -lmpi -L/opt/FSUNaprun/lib -lmpl -lemi -lthread"  
     AC_DEFINE([MPI])      AC_DEFINE([MPI])
 fi  fi
 AC_SUBST([MPIINC])  
 AC_SUBST([MPILIB])  
   
 dnl AC_ARG_WITH([lapack],  dnl AC_ARG_WITH([lapack],
 dnl [  --with-lapack           use the LAPACK library. [[no]]],  dnl [  --with-lapack           use the LAPACK library. [[no]]],
Line 184  case "${host}" in
Line 189  case "${host}" in
     asm_obj="${i386_elf_obj}"      asm_obj="${i386_elf_obj}"
     AC_DEFINE([_BSD_SOURCE])      AC_DEFINE([_BSD_SOURCE])
     ;;      ;;
 *-*-cygwin*)  [i[3-6]86-*-cygwin*]|x86-*-cygwin*)
     asm_obj="${i386_aout_obj}"      asm_obj="${i386_aout_obj}"
     ;;      ;;
 [i[3-6]86-*-interix*])  [i[3-6]86-*-interix*])
     asm_obj="${i386_aout_obj}"      asm_obj="${i386_aout_obj}"
     USE_GC_INTERIX="yes"  
     AC_SUBST([USE_GC_INTERIX])  
     AC_DEFINE([_ALL_SOURCE])      AC_DEFINE([_ALL_SOURCE])
     ;;      ;;
 sparc-sun-solaris2.*)  sparc-sun-solaris2.*)
Line 209  sparc-sun-solaris2.*)
Line 212  sparc-sun-solaris2.*)
 *-apple-darwin*)  *-apple-darwin*)
     asm_obj="${generic_obj}"      asm_obj="${generic_obj}"
     AC_DEFINE([__DARWIN__])      AC_DEFINE([__DARWIN__])
       if test -d /usr/X11/include -a x"${X_CFLAGS}" = x ; then
           X_CFLAGS=-I/usr/X11/include
       fi
     ;;      ;;
 arm*-*-linux*)  arm*-*-linux*)
     asm_obj="${generic_obj}"      asm_obj="${generic_obj}"
Line 216  arm*-*-linux*)
Line 222  arm*-*-linux*)
         CFLAGS="${CFLAGS} -fsigned-char"          CFLAGS="${CFLAGS} -fsigned-char"
     fi      fi
     ;;      ;;
   *-*-mingw*)
           WSLIB="-lws2_32"
       asm_obj="${generic_obj}"
       ;;
 *)  *)
     asm_obj="${generic_obj}"      asm_obj="${generic_obj}"
     ;;      ;;
 esac  esac
   
 AC_SUBST([asm_obj])  AC_SUBST([asm_obj])
   AC_SUBST([WSLIB])
   
   AC_CHECK_FUNCS(sigaction)
 dnl for Solaris 2.x  dnl for Solaris 2.x
 AC_CHECK_FUNC(socket, , [AC_CHECK_LIB(socket,socket)])  AC_CHECK_FUNC(socket, , [AC_CHECK_LIB(socket,socket)])
 AC_CHECK_FUNC(gethostbyname, , [AC_CHECK_LIB(nsl,gethostbyname)])  AC_CHECK_FUNC(gethostbyname, , [AC_CHECK_LIB(nsl,gethostbyname)])
   
 AC_CONFIG_FILES([Makefile engine/Makefile asm/Makefile builtin/Makefile fft/Makefile include/Makefile io/Makefile lib/Makefile parse/Makefile plot/Makefile])  AC_CONFIG_FILES([Makefile engine/Makefile asm/Makefile builtin/Makefile fft/Makefile include/Makefile io/Makefile lib/Makefile parse/Makefile plot/Makefile asir2000])
 AC_OUTPUT  AC_OUTPUT

Legend:
Removed from v.1.25  
changed lines
  Added in v.1.52

F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>